  How a 17th-Century Monastery in Provence Turned EV Charging Into a “Set It and Forget It” Revenue Stream As electric vehicles become mainstream across Europe, hospitality businesses are facing a new expectation: Guests don’t just ask, “Do you have parking?” They ask, “Do you have EV charging?” For some properties, especially independent guest houses and retreat centers, this creates a dilemma: How do you provide EV charging without creating operational complexity? This was exactly the question faced by Monastère de Ségriès , a historic guest house in Provence, France. A Unique Hospitality Setting Monastère de Ségriès is not a typical hotel. Located in the heart of Provence, the property is a restored former monastery that now hosts: Retreats Corporate seminars Weddings and celebrations Fully catered private events It’s a family-run business with deep roots — in fact, the family has lived there longer than the monks once did. The rise of electric vehicles (EVs) is reshaping how people think about transportation and energy use. More homeowners and tenants are shifting toward sustainable mobility, but one major challenge remains—convenient and accessible EV charging in residential buildings. For condominiums and apartment complexes, installing EV charging stations is no longer just a luxury amenity—it is quickly becoming necessary. Residents with electric vehicles need a reliable charging solution close to home, and buildings that provide it will have a significant competitive edge over those that don’t. However, many property owners, landlords, and homeowners’ associations (HOAs) hesitate to install EV chargers due to concerns about costs, energy management, billing, and infrastructure upgrades.
